One more sort of interaction through which the electron can lose its kinetic energy provides the next technique of X-ray generation, a result of the conversation from the electron with the nucleus of the goal atom. As the colliding electron passes via the nucleus of the anode atom, it's slowed down and deviated in its class, leaving with diminished kinetic Power in another course. This loss in kinetic Electrical power reappears as an X-ray photon. This kind of X-rays is referred to as Bremsstrahlung, where “bremsen” may be the German verb for slowing down. The level of kinetic Power that may be dropped in this manner can vary from zero to the whole incident Electricity. Though the characteristic radiation results in a discrete X-ray spectrum of characteristic peaks, the Bremsstrahlung delivers a continuous spectrum.

These facts are then plotted with a semilogarithmic graph to ascertain HVL. If the beam has a reduced filtration or includes an appreciable level of minimal-Electricity ingredient during the spectrum, the slope of the attenuation curve decreases with growing absorber thickness (Fig. 5.3). xray filter Hence, diverse HVL beams is often attained from this kind of beam by making use of distinctive filters. In general, the HVL increases with growing filter thickness because the beam turns into progressively “more difficult,” which is, is made website up of a increased proportion of increased-Vitality photons. Past a certain thickness, having said that, more filtration may possibly lead to “softening” of the beam by Compton scattering.
